Our Funding Portfolio

The Volkswagen Foundation is dedicated to the support of the humanities and social sciences as well as science and technology in higher education and research. It funds research projects in path-breaking areas and provides assistance to academic institutions for the improvement of the structural conditions for their work.

    Researching Research: Strengthening University Centres

    The funding offer is aimed at established centres, institutes or research priority areas for Science Studies at universities in Germany that have been institutionalised in recent years and are striving for further structural development.

    Transformational Knowledge on Democracies under Change – Transdisciplinary Perspectives

    The programme addresses persons from science together with actors outside of academia who are interested in transdisciplinary research and aim at jointly developing new perspectives on democratic forms of government under change.

    AI Research Groups Lower Saxony

    As a key technology, artificial intelligence is of central importance to Lower Saxony's research system. This call for proposals combines the objectives of promoting individual scientists with the further development of AI methods and their application to existing data sets.

    Night Science – Space for the Creative Mind

    The funding programme is aimed at interdisciplinary tandems of two scientists who are open to unconventional approaches and have the desire to develop and implement innovative ideas for their research.

    Transdisciplinary Approaches to Mobility and Global Health

    The call is directed at researchers from HICs and LMICs, in close collaboration with local communities, non-academic stakeholders and other relevant actors. It is jointly initiated by the three independent private foundations Novo Nordisk Foundation (Denmark), Wellcome (Great Britain) and Volkswagen Foundation.
